The Quickdraw Animation Society is seeking a SCiP intern to support the creation of a publication and screening series exploring the role of LGBTQ+ creators in the field of animation.

Working with Quickdraw’s Programming Director and the LGBTQ+ Zine committee, this assistant will help in corresponding with selected writers, arranging permissions and screening fees for selected films, and other general administrative support for the project.

It will culminate in the publication of a book collecting essays on four broad themes around queer animation history, along with a screening at the 15th GIRAF festival of independent animation.

An ideal candidate for this position will be someone with a passion for animation and film programming, and with an understanding of the issues surrounding queer representation in media. Candidates who are pursuing a career in arts administration and festival programming will be given preference.
